With an acceptance rate of 6%, Columbia is the most selective Ivy League school outside of Harvard. The University received 40,084 applications in 2020 – more than Brown, Dartmouth, Princeton, and Yale – and accepted only 2,544. Most Ivy decisions come out at the end of March or the beginning of April on Ivy League Decision Day (colloquially known as “Ivy Day”). Ivy League Decision Day is when all Ivy schools release admissions decisions on the same day.

Which Ivy League is easiest to get into? If we look at actual acceptance rates, Cornell University has the highest overall acceptance rate out of the eight Ivy League universities. However, Dartmouth College has an early decision acceptance rate of 23.2% in comparison to Cornell’s early acceptance rate of 22.7%.Welcome to the ultimate source for annual Ivy League acceptance rates and statistics. Ivy Coach has been curating these admissions figures for two decades, from the Class of …In the Early Decision round at Brown University, 896 students from a record pool of 6,146 applicants to the Class of 2026 earned admission. This marks a 14.6% Early Decision admission rate for Brown’s Class of 2026 — a historic low for the Ivy League institution based in Providence, Rhode Island. Brown University. Brown set records this year for both total applicants and acceptance rates. Total applicants peaked at over 38,000 for the class of 2023, while the acceptance rate dipped to a record low of 6.6%. This acceptance rate is over half a percent below the previous year’s record of 7.24%. Yes, there is a common date when Ivy League schools release their admissions decisions. For Regular Decision applicants, decisions are typically released on "Ivy Day," which occurs on a specified date in late March or early April each year. Overall, of the nearly 40,000 (wow!) applicants, Harvard College offered admission to 2,056 students. This marked an admit rate of 5.2%, the lowest admission rate among the eight Ivy League schools for the Class of 2021. It also happened to be the admit rate for last year’s Harvard class — so things stayed steady.

Brown accepted 617 of the 3,016 early applications received for the class of 2019. The university deferred 1,968 applications to the regular admission round and rejected 408. The 3,016 applications for early decision this year represent a slight decrease from last year’s 3,088.
